Arch Manning Takes Center Stage

Arch Manning, the highly touted redshirt freshman, is set to make his second consecutive start at quarterback for the No. 1 ranked Texas Longhorns this Saturday against Mississippi State. This comes as starting quarterback Quinn Ewers continues his recovery from an abdominal strain, leaving the team looking for a strong performance from its young star, according to reports from 247Sports.

Quinn Ewers' Status

Ewers has been listed as questionable for the matchup, and while he participated in practice, he is officially ruled out for the game. Texas, favored by a whopping 38.5 points, has decided to play it safe with Ewers, a leading Heisman contender. Coach Steve Sarkisian's decision is made easier by the Longhorns' bye week following this game, which provides Ewers extra time to recuperate before the critical Red River Rivalry showdown against Oklahoma on October 12.

Manning's Challenge and Opportunity

Manning's appointment as starter not only gives him crucial game experience but also places him in a less pressured environment against a struggling Mississippi State team. The Bulldogs, with a dismal record of 1-3, are experiencing a challenging transition under first-year head coach Jeff Lebby. They are currently positioned as the 111th ranked team in total defense nationally, which could bode well for Manning's development.

Manning's Performance So Far

In his inaugural start last week, Manning showcased his potential by completing 15 of 29 passes for 258 yards, along with two touchdowns and two interceptions, in a dominant 51-3 victory over UL-Monroe. His performance marked the most extensive playing time of his career, but it did reveal areas where he still needs refinement, especially considering his inexperience.

Looking Ahead

Manning's journey began when he stepped in for Ewers during the Longhorns’ last game against UTSA on September 14. Not only did he show flashes of brilliance by accumulating five total touchdowns, but also demonstrated mobility with a jaw-dropping 67-yard touchdown run. Throughout the current season, Manning has thrown for 576 yards on 29-of-47 passing, including seven touchdowns and two interceptions, alongside two rushing touchdowns.
